Why Wendy's Shares Dropped Sharply on Wednesday
Yahoo Finance ·
Wendy's stock experienced a significant downturn, dropping nearly 6% (specifically down 5.76%) during Wednesday's trading session. Investor sentiment remained under pressure following the termination of a potential take-private transaction in late August. Adding to the negative momentum, Seaport Global Securities initiated coverage on the fast-food operator with a neutral rating. Analyst Eric Gonzalez highlighted that the company's fundamental metrics are deteriorating at an unprecedented pace in its lengthy operating history. Supporting this cautious outlook, Wendy's reported a 7% year-over-year slump in same-restaurant sales for its most recent quarter, alongside a sharp 12.5% decline in customer foot traffic. Furthermore, Gonzalez noted the recent reduction of the quarterly dividend to $0.07 per share and expressed skepticism regarding any meaningful sales recovery throughout the third and fourth quarters of the year.
